February is the most popular time to visit Curl Curl, New South Wales, as it falls within the peak season of December to February. During this vibrant summer period, visitors flock to enjoy the stunning beaches, sparkling waters, and a lot of outdoor activities that the area has to offer. With temperatures typically ranging from 20 to 30 degrees Celsius, it's a great backdrop for sunbathing, swimming, or partaking in water sports.Curl Curl is particularly alive in February, with families and groups seeking the thrill of beachside adventures, from surfing to beach volleyball. The nearby coastal walks also provide splendid views and a chance to connect with nature, making it an ideal destination for those who appreciate the great outdoors.If you're looking for a more budget-friendly option, consider visiting in July. While this is the low season, it offers a unique opportunity to enjoy the coastal beauty without the peak crowds. The winter months can bring a cooler climate, with temperatures around 10 to 18 degrees Celsius, but this can be a fantastic time for relaxed beach walks and enjoying the local cafes in a quieter setting.Ultimately, your choice of when to visit Curl Curl will depend on whether you prefer the bustling atmosphere of summer in February or the peaceful charm of winter in July.
